Recent improvements to SUNCAT. A recent release of SUNCAT includes two new features: My SUNCAT, and a serials holdings comparison service. My SUNCAT allows users to sign in to SUNCAT and save searches to reuse at a later date, save records and organise them into lists, and create custom groups of libraries and locations to use in searches.
